branch: emacs-26
commit 34ee26dd93613849802bfe40cd7fae3df0b57fd1
Author: Stefan Kangas <address@hidden>
Commit: Eli Zaretskii <address@hidden>
Add warning to bidi-display-reordering doc string
This explanation was given by Eli Zaretskii on emacs-devel.
For discussion, see:
https://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/emacs-devel/2019-07/msg00294.html
* src/buffer.c (syms_of_buffer): Add warning to doc string of
bidi-display-reordering to explain that it should only be used for
debugging.
